The End of The World (Surf League) As We Know It: “I Think It’s A Great Idea” – Ryan Callinan

Paul Evans

11th May 2020

It’s Not The Length Podcast is back as hosts Evans & Mondy reconvene to consider all things lockdown, shred & life.

Could this be the end of the World Surf League as we know it?

Mondy reached out to Ryan Callinan who doesn’t seem to think so, he’s excited about the new world title decider surf off format.

Your hosts aren’t so sure.

Meanwhile, we learn that Mondy’s efforts as part time freelance zero hours subcontractor co-scriptwriter on the WSL’s ‘Surf Breaks’ has landed him 1/12th of a Webby Award nomination, with the famously hard to please judging panel claiming some of the technical quality of the writing reminded them of Marcel Proust’s ‘In The Shadow of Young Girls In Flower’.

Impressive stuff.

Elsewhere, hot topics include Zoom pub quizzes, Ben body shaming Laird’s sagging rig, and female longboarders’ hang tens resembling ‘the girly tuck’.

Also, why does the Portuguese government hate the Malloys?

How did joint 2020 CT wildcard L Fioravanti’s juxtapose bad posture with female objectification?

What app did Mondy use to order edibles on dark web? What did he opt for, and how much was postage & packaging?

All this, and much more featured in the episode. Be sure to subscribe via your phone’s podcast app, or wherever it is you get your pods.
